700 miles due west of Lima Peru, still heading south
Many shades of blue.
www.google.com/maps/place/-12.12424,-89.99291
Cheers
We are here right now
Leave a reply
700 miles due west of Lima Peru, still heading south
Many shades of blue.
www.google.com/maps/place/-12.12424,-89.99291
Cheers